The Trust are in the process of building a stand alone data warehouse, designed as a single platform to ingest data from all Trust systems, creating a single source from which we can deliver operational and clinical dashboards. The successful candidate will need to be able to demonstrate significant practical experience in architecting, designing and delivering solutions to deliver the Trust’s vision. This will need an in-depth knowledge of Data Lakes, Data modelling techniques, Data security management, ETL / ELT pipelines and orchestration products. The role will work with Microsoft SQL Server and Query optimisation, Unicode Collation sets and for integration architecture will use REST APIs and FHIR/HL7 messaging.
The role will manage and build a small team using Agile project management methodologies to deliver the Trust’s data programme. As well as having a robust practical knowledge of programming languages, you’ll need to be a good communicator and able to translate complex technical concepts to audiences at all levels.
